Another essential chemical in sewage treatment is alum, or aluminum sulfate. Alum is a coagulant used in the primary treatment phase to facilitate the removal of suspended solids and colloidal particles. By causing these particles to clump together, or coagulate, alum aids in their subsequent removal through sedimentation. This is particularly important in reducing the turbidity of wastewater, thus improving the efficiency of subsequent treatment processes. The addition of alum not only enhances removal rates but also aids in the stabilization of organic matter.

Silicone foam seals are made from silicone, a synthetic polymer that exhibits an array of beneficial characteristics. The foam structure provides excellent cushioning, while the silicone material itself is known for its resilience and stability. This combination produces seals that can effectively absorb shocks, vibrations, and impacts, making them ideal for numerous industrial and commercial applications.

A mechanical seal is a device used to seal the interface between rotating equipment, usually a shaft, and a stationary component, like a pump housing. Its primary purpose is to prevent the leakage of fluids while containing pressure within the system. Unlike traditional packing seals, mechanical seals are more durable, provide less wear on equipment, and require minimal maintenance. These aspects make them increasingly popular in modern engineering applications.

Weather stripping refers to materials used to seal gaps around doors and windows to prevent air, water, and dust infiltration. By creating a tight barrier, weather stripping helps maintain a steady indoor temperature, reducing the need for heating and cooling systems to work overtime. This not only enhances comfort but also results in substantial savings on energy bills.

- The 12mm mechanical seal is typically used in pumps, mixers, and other types of rotating equipment that handle corrosive or abrasive fluids. Its compact size allows it to fit into tight spaces while still providing the necessary seal to prevent leaks. The seal consists of two main components – a stationary component and a rotating component. The stationary component is attached to the housing of the machine, while the rotating component is attached to the shaft that moves with the rotation of the equipment.

1. Prevention of Water Leakage The primary function of the edge seal is to prevent water from escaping the shower area. Without an effective seal, water can seep out, leading to puddles on the bathroom floor. This not only creates a slippery hazard but can also lead to long-term water damage to the floor and walls, resulting in costly repairs and maintenance.
